Investing Outside Shares: Other Business Investment Choices

Although numerous people concentrate on equities , it's important to recognize a range of other enterprise funding possibilities accessible to individuals. These avenues may include non-public equity , venture investments, physical estate syndications , direct loans, and surprisingly investing in rare items including fine pieces or classic cars . Each approach provides unique risks and upsides that should be thoroughly reviewed before making any financial commitment .
